Программирование > Perl
массив переменных из HTTP
(1/1)
Paul56:
Доброго времени суток.
Подскажите пожалуйста ответ на следующий вопрос:
Есть запрос следующего типа:
http://name_list.cgi?all_id=1&id=1&id=2&id=3&id=4 ....
как получить все значения переменной id в массив или в переменную. что то вроде $all_id=\'1,2,3,4,...\';
За ранее благодарен.
xmolex:
$text = $ENV{\'QUERY_STRING\'};
$text =~ s/all_id=//g; # если "all_id=" есть конечно
$text =~ s/&//g;
$text =~ s/id=//g;
print $text;
Paul56:
Благодарю. Оказывается всё элемертано.
Green Kakadu:
это делается стандартными методами (не важно POST или GET)
--- Код: ---
use CGI;
$q = CGI->new();
my @vals = $q->param(\'id\');
--- Конец кода ---
Навигация
Перейти к полной версии